Case-control Study
A research design in which participants with a certain outcome or disease are compared to those without, to identify and evaluate risk factors or outcomes.
Cholera Infections
A highly contagious bacterial disease causing severe diarrhea and dehydration, usually spread through contaminated water.
Selection Bias
A bias in how participants are chosen to participate in a study, leading to results that may not be generalizable to the larger population.
Tertiary Care
Specialized consultative healthcare, usually for inpatients and on referral from a primary or secondary health professional, involving advanced medical investigation and treatment.
